Lehigh Valley Penn housing market in a slump
Submitted by Anonymous on Mon, 07/30/2007 - 05:00.The Morning Call from Pennsylvania reveals, “The average price of a home in the Lehigh Valley rose 2 percent in the first half of the year. It’s been five years since home appreciation hit such a low level here.”
“The rate of appreciation has slowed as home sales have fallen and new listings have soared. For every one home that has sold this year, 2.5 homes have been listed for sale.”
